Question to the Department for Work and Pensions:

To ask His Majesty's Government what was the maximum apprenticeship funding available in (1) 2019, (2) 2022, and (3) 2025, for the apprenticeship standards for (a) chartered managers, (b) human resource managers, and (c) senior leaders; and what was the average duration of funding for each of those standards.


Answered by
Baroness Smith of Malvern Portrait
Baroness Smith of Malvern
Minister of State (Department for Work and Pensions)
This question was answered on 28th April 2026

The typical duration from apprenticeship start date to apprenticeship gateway and the maximum funding available for standards (a) to (c) are in the below table. This information is published at Apprenticeship search / Skills England.

Apprenticeship standard

Maximum funding in 2019

Maximum funding in 2022

Maximum funding in 2025

Typical duration

Chartered manager

£22,000

£22,000

£22,000

48 months

HR Support

£4,500

£4,500

£4,500

18 Months

Senior leader

£18,000

£14,000

£14,000

24 months
